2009-10-15 1 views
1

Вот моя проблема: я собираюсь разработать и реализовать довольно большой модуль продаж поверх существующего бизнес-приложения. В основном мне нужно - полный уровень электронной коммерции без публичной части (мне не нужна тележка, платежные шлюзы и т. Д.). Я собираюсь построить эту штуку с нуля, так как я не хочу взломать какие-либо существующие решения (я использую Rails, просто чтобы закончить рисунок). Я размышлял обо всем этом некоторое время и проверил некоторые из существующих решений для вдохновения о том, как начать мое моделирование данных. Я довольно далеко от модели сейчас, однако, я не могу удержаться, чтобы почувствовать, что (по крайней мере, до некоторой степени) я изобретаю колесо здесь. Я имею в виду, что там должны быть тысячи моделей данных, которые похожи (если не совпадают) с моими. Я пытался найти некоторых из них, но не имел большого успеха. То, что я хочу, - это не полная модель базы данных, а просто логическая модель, которую я могу использовать в качестве контрольного списка, когда делаю свою собственную вещь. То, что я нашел до сих пор, - это всего лишь this site, который представляет собой сборник моделей баз данных без какого-либо описания или причин моделей.Есть ли сайт, на котором искать вдохновение для моделирования данных?

Итак, мой вопрос: Знаете ли вы о каких-либо сайтах, где искать вдохновение для моделирования данных?

EDIT: Поскольку ни один из ответов пока не предоставил мне то, что я ищу, я попытаюсь уточнить свой вопрос. Я не ищу какие-либо конкретные диаграммы базы данных (и, как я уже говорил, меня не интересует обратное проектирование других существующих систем), и мне не нужно изучать предмет моделирования данных в целом. Я ищу что-то вроде онлайн-версии this book. Трудно поверить, что нет ничего подобного.

Благодарю вас, во всяком случае.

ответ

3

This site ранее упоминался в stackoverflow и имеет множество относительно несовместных системных реляционных баз данных.

+1

«этот сайт» упоминается в вопросе ... oops ... – mjv

+0

Это все еще хорошее место для поиска. Вы можете начать с одной из своих моделей и попытаться выяснить причину этого. Это, по существу, обратное проектирование из дизайна базы данных обратно к требованиям к информации. Это поможет вам понять ваши данные. –

0

OSCommerce - это решение для электронной коммерции с открытым исходным кодом. Если вы получите источники, я думаю, вы также получите скрипты создания db, чтобы вы могли изучить их модель данных.

0

Возможно, вы можете посмотреть проект Apache Ofbiz. Его дизайн основан на справочной книге модели данных, которую вы упоминаете. У них есть онлайн-демонстрация здесь: http://demo.ofbiz.org/ecommerce/control/main